c> ='a' && c <='z'//A code that is true if c is a lowercase letter
public class Main {
    public static void main(String[] args){
    char c = 'c';
    
    System.out.printf("The character c you want to check is?  '%s'\n", c);
    /*True if c is a lowercase letter*/
    if (c >= 'a' && c <= 'z')
        System.out.println("c is lowercase");
    /*True if c is lowercase*/
    if (c >= 'a' && c <= 'z')        
        System.out.println("c is lowercase");
    else
        System.out.println("c is not lowercase");
    /*True if c is a number*/
    if (c >= '0' && c <= '9')       
        System.out.println("c is a number");
    else
        System.out.println("c is not a number");
    /*c is'+'Or'-'Then true*/
    if (c == '+' || c == '-')     
        System.out.println("c is the sign");
    else
        System.out.println("c is not a sign");
    }
}
The character c you want to check is?  'c'
c is lowercase
c is lowercase
c is not a number
c is not a sign

Create a program that counts the number of each alphabet contained in the given English sentence. Note that lowercase and uppercase letters are not distinguished. Input You will be given one English sentence that spans multiple lines. Output Please output the number of each alphabet contained in the given English sentence in the format shown below: a: Number of a b: Number of b c: Number of c . . z: Number of z Constraints
import java.util.Scanner;
public class Main {
    public static void main(String[] args){
        Scanner scan=new Scanner(System.in);
        int alf[]=new int[26];
        while(scan.hasNext()){
            String str=scan.next().toLowerCase();
            for(int i=0;i<str.length();i++){
                char c=str.charAt(i);
                if('a'<=c&&c<='z'){
                    alf[str.charAt(i)-'a']++;
                }
            }
        }
        for(int i=0;i<26;i++)System.out.println((char)('a'+i)+" : "+alf[i]);
        scan.close();
    }
}
